The suspended rugby union star Kurtley Beale will stand trial in January accused of sexually assaulting a woman after an alleged attack at a Sydney pub.
The 34-year-old formally pleaded not guilty to one count of sexual intercourse without consent and two counts of sexual touching when he appeared in Downing Centre district court on Friday.
